Immersive event production is the on-site execution phase that transforms fabricated elements into a live experience. It covers everything from truck logistics and load-in scheduling to installation, technical integration, and post-event strike — the critical last mile that determines whether your event opens on time.

The Team That Built It Installs It
Most fabrication companies hand off installation to a third-party labor company. The crew that shows up at your venue has never seen your project. They’re reading assembly instructions written by someone else, interpreting engineering drawings they didn’t create, and making judgment calls about a structure they don’t understand. That’s how panels get installed backwards, connections get forced, and finishes get scratched.
At PUYB, the fabricators who built your project are the same people who install it. The carpenter who framed your scenic wall is the one shimming it level on the venue floor. The welder who joined your steel structure is the one bolting it to the deck. The painter who matched your brand color is the one doing touch-ups on site.
This continuity eliminates the single biggest source of on-site problems: the knowledge gap between builder and installer. Our crew knows every joint, every connection, every hidden fastener, and every finish detail because they created them. When something needs adjusting on site — and something always needs adjusting — they don’t call the shop for instructions. They already know the answer.

Load-In to Lights On
Venue walkthroughs, load-in schedules, labor calls, rigging plans, and equipment lists — finalized before the truck rolls.
We coordinate freight, drayage, dock scheduling, and union labor requirements. Every element arrives on time and in sequence.
Our crew assembles, levels, finishes, and tests every element on-site. Lighting, AV, and interactive tech are integrated and tested before you see it.
Post-event dismantlement, packing, and removal on your timeline. We leave the venue exactly as we found it.

Immersive event production is the on-site execution of fabricated event environments — covering logistics, installation, technical integration, and strike. It bridges the gap between a finished fabrication in the shop and a live experience on the venue floor. Production management includes load-in scheduling, labor coordination, rigging, and real-time problem-solving.
Venue coordination and load-in logistics are core components of event production management. This includes dock reservations, freight elevator scheduling, load-in sequencing, fire marshal compliance, union labor coordination, and facility protection. Production teams with venue-specific experience prevent the scheduling and operational issues that commonly delay installations.
Union labor coordination at major convention centers is a standard capability for experienced production teams. This includes managing labor calls, jurisdictional requirements, and union rules at facilities like Javits Center, McCormick Place, Mandalay Bay, and other major convention venues nationwide.
Event installation timelines typically range from 4 hours for simple activations to 5 days for large-scale experiential environments, with mid-scale trade show booths requiring 1-2 days of on-site assembly. Builds engineered for efficient on-site assembly minimize both labor costs and venue rental time compared to designs created without installation logistics in mind.
On-site production support throughout an event handles real-time adjustments, repairs, or last-minute changes. Multi-day events typically benefit from a dedicated production manager who serves as the single point of contact for all fabrication-related needs during the live event period.
